Grow Your Own in Middlesbrough

Just think how great it would be to make a family dinner with something you’ve grown yourself. Middlesbrough will be transformed into a haven for organically-grown food and you don’t need a garden to get involved. Look out for new allotments, gardening clubs and organic farms springing up across town. There’ll even be a chance to get digging and planting in backyards and alleyways.
